PHILIP COMLEY
CORICOPAT

Philip trained at Laine Theatre Arts in Surrey having begun dancing at the Coreen Bailey School of Dance in his home town of Oxford. Upon graduating Philip appeared in Ready Steady Dance with Wayne Sleep and also Swing From the Heart at the Mayflower Theatre, Southampton. In 2002 Philip made his West End debut in the original cast of Chitty Chitty Bang Bang at the London Palladium. He can also be heard on the original cast recording and seen on the making of video/DVD. Television appearances include Blue Peter, Children in Need 2002 and ITV’s Christmas Show. Most recently Philip would have been seen playing the Cheesegrater in the UK tour of Disney’s Beauty and the Beast. Philip played Carbucketty on the last tour of Cats and also performed the role of Mr Mistoffelees on many occasions.
